As a moderately sized elementary campus in LINCOLN, Nebraska, 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L instructs 360 students from grades pre-K through 5, one of the schools within LINCOLN PUBLIC SCHOOLS. That puts it 32% larger than the typical public school in Nebraska, which averages around 272 students.
LINCOLN PUBLIC SCHOOLS runs 67 schools in total, collectively educating 42,301 students. 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is one of those campuses.
For racial and ethnic makeup, 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L records that the largest single group is White, at 67% of enrollment. The remainder consists of 16% Hispanic, 11% multiracial, 5% Black. The wider county runs roughly 81% White, putting the school's mix considerably less White than the area baseline.
Looking at school resources, 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L shows 27 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 13.3: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 21.0:1, putting 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L tighter than the state norm the norm. Around 38%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ator.
With demographic context factored in, 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L performs roughly as the BeatsExpectations model predicts for a school with this FRL share. The predicted value is around 63.1%, the actual is 61.0%, a residual of -2.2 points.
In the broader community, the surrounding county (Lancaster County) records that the typical household earns roughly $74,793 per year, roughly 42%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 7%. 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is one of 97 public schools in Lancaster County (combined enrollment of about 48,123 students).
POUND MIDDLE SCHOOL is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.5 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L. Among the 8 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), ZEMAN ELEMENTARY SCHOOL ranks 7th on composite proficiency, behind the local average of 67.3%.
The school occupies a high-density site.
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count ticked down 14%: 420 students in 2018 compared to 360 in 2025.
